Commercial Slab Construction in Cary, NC
Commercial slab construction services involve the design and installation of concrete foundations for various types of commercial projects, including warehouses, retail stores, office buildings, and industrial facilities. These services typically encompass site preparation, foundation pouring, and ensuring the slab meets the structural and load-bearing requirements of the specific project. Property owners often seek information on the durability, size, and specifications of the slabs to ensure they support the intended use and comply with local building codes.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including site conditions, materials used, and the expected lifespan of the foundation. Clarifying the project's size, purpose, and any special considerations-such as drainage or utility access-can help ensure the construction meets the needs of the property. Proper planning and communication about these details can contribute to a successful and long-lasting foundation for commercial development.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or storage spaces on property sites.
What are the benefits of a concrete slab for commercial properties? Concrete slabs provide a durable, stable surface that supports heavy equipment and high traffic areas efficiently.
How is a commercial slab constructed? Construction involves site preparation, form setting, reinforcement placement, and pouring concrete to create a solid, level surface.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ate the load requirements, drainage needs, and future usage plans for the area.
